以文本方式查看主题

-  Foxtable(狐表)  (http://www.foxtable.com/bbs/index.asp)
--  专家坐堂  (http://www.foxtable.com/bbs/list.asp?boardid=2)
----  sql数据源的日期的引用符号  (http://www.foxtable.com/bbs/dispbbs.asp?boardid=2&id=109599)

--  作者:有点辣
--  发布时间:2017/11/15 14:39:00
--  sql数据源的日期的引用符号
项目是用sql数据源的
在用sqlfind查找后台数据时,日期条件的引用,我知道是用 \' 

我现在想改为,先用sqlcommand生成一个临时的datatable
然后再对这个临时表做日期的查询

请问这时候的日期的引用,应该是#号还是\'号?

因为项目在运行中,不敢乱测试,怕乱了数据
请老师能解答一下,谢谢。

--  作者:有点甜
--  发布时间:2017/11/15 14:50:00
--  

写sql语句在数据库查询的,就都用单引号

 

写代码在foxtable内部查询的,都用#号


--  作者:有点辣
--  发布时间:2017/11/15 14:53:00
--  
以下是引用有点甜在2017/11/15 14:50:00的发言:

写sql语句在数据库查询的,就都用单引号

 

写代码在foxtable内部查询的,都用#号

用sqlcommand生成的临时表,是属于狐表内部的表了还仍是外部表呢?


--  作者:有点甜
--  发布时间:2017/11/15 14:57:00
--  
以下是引用有点辣在2017/11/15 14:53:00的发言:

用sqlcommand生成的临时表,是属于狐表内部的表了还仍是外部表呢?

 

如果是find、select等,就用#号

 

如果是sqlFind之类的,还是用\'号